Pam Ford is a comedian with oodles of personality!
A Birmingham Born woman with strong Aussie accent, this former Pub landlady turned comedian, soon out grew her small Kent village pub to perform her unique comedy set in comedy clubs and Theatre's all over the UK and Europe.
A regular performer at The Edinburgh Fringe has given me a wealth of experience and material, stand up comedy is my passion, I am able to react and relate to a wide variety of audiences from top Blackpool & Liverpool Comedy Clubs, Pubs, weddings and corporate events to weddings & birthdays.
Pam is simply hilarious. She commands the stage, has great material and is superb at working an audience.

Dundee's finest comedian Steve Mcleod burst onto the scottish comedy scene in 2018 and is now one of scotland's rising comedy stars. Steve got hooked into comedy by attending one of our comedian recruitment open days. Since then he has over 100 shows under his belt, performed at the biggest clubs in the UK and has recently supported top names such as Larry Dean, Gary Meikle and Fred MacAulay and now performs all over the UK.
His warm charm and funny will certainly cheer you up.

Neil is an accomplished motivational and humorous after dinner speaker and Aberdeen's blind comedian, as Neil says “if there’s another, I’ve not seen them”. Neil can adjust his many tales and stories to suit any occasion and his humour goes down well with male and female audiences alike and is perfect for corporate occasions or as a solo cabaret act. He has done over 100 gigs for Breakneck and each time the crowd just erupt into laughter. The man is simply a comedy genuis.
Neil has also recently supported Karen Dunbar on her Scottish tour & Judy Murray at The Music Hall.
He witty determined passionate Scot who tells it how it is, Neil is totally blind due to Glaucoma and has been since his teenage years. He was educated at Sunnybank Primary in Aberdeen before attending Powis Academy
